Double Glazing Windows Repair

Double glazing window repair can resolve various issues with your frames and windows. However, more significant issues can be resolved by replacing the window.

The most frequent issues are condensation and fog. A professional will reseal and add vents to prevent this happening again in the future.

Condensation

Double glazing is designed to provide insulation and help reduce costs for energy, but condensation can cause issues. If you're seeing visible condensation, it means the airtight seal is not working and a professional has to visit to look. It could be as simple as changing the seal or replacing the glass or installing a new window.

Visible condensation is the most typical problem with double-glazed windows. It's typically caused by moisture or humidity in the air. Water droplets form on cold surfaces, and when the window is closed, they can accumulate and create a white fog or frost. This isn't an issue however it does mean the glass and frame must be cleaned regularly to get rid of dust and residues which can cause mold growth or wood rot.

The best solution is to improve the ventilation in the home. Make sure the extractor fan is running while you shower or cook and also open a window while drying laundry. A window that is the right size can also aid in reducing levels of moisture (not too large or small). The distance between the window panes should not be greater than 12mm in order to allow more energy efficiency and to prevent air infiltration.

If your windows are getting misty up it could be that they need to be replaced entirely. A repair kit can be used to fix double glazing that has been blown, but it will only fix the problem with the seal, and will not solve any ice or condensation that may have formed within the windowpanes. A local tradesman can drill into the window, spray an agent to clean it, and then use a defogger get rid of it.


A professional can fix misting windows by identifying the cause. It is likely that the entire window will need to be replaced, particularly when there are signs of rot or mold. Although replacing one window might seem costly, it will save you money on heating and energy in the long run.

Blown

If water seeps through the gaps in your double-glazed windows, it's probably due to the seal failing. This is known as a "blown" window, and it means that the window cannot be fixed. It needs to be replaced. This is a task that should be left to professionals, as a faulty window can allow cold air into your home and warm air to escape. This will impact the energy efficiency of your home. A blown window can also cause condensation and dampness which is the reason it's crucial to address the issue immediately.

There are a variety of reasons for why the seal between double-glazed windows might fail, but this is typically caused by age and general wear and tear. If the seal is damaged it allows moisture to leak into this gap which leads to condensation and fogging.

Foggy windows not only reduce visibility, but they also reduce the amount of sunlight that enters your living space and create an unattractive look to your property. Repairing broken double glazing can restore the clarity and insulation properties that reduce heating costs, as well as improving the appearance of your home.

It is important to know that replacing windows with double glazing that have blown out is a specialist task. This is not a job you can tackle yourself. It requires special tools to take out the old glass and replace it. If you attempt to do this yourself, you could be putting yourself at risk of injury. It is also crucial to take the correct measurements to ensure that the replacement window will be of the correct size and will fit perfectly into the frame. Double-glazing experts can assist you with this, and will ensure that your new glass is correctly fitted and is functioning effectively. They will also install trickle ventilation to prevent future build-up of condensation. Double-glazed windows that are blowing must be replaced as soon as they can since they let cold air into your home and warm energy to escape. They can also be the perfect breeding ground for mould and dampness, which could be hazardous to your health.

Misted

If you notice a layer of moisture between your double-glazed windows, it is a sign that there is an issue with the seal. This means that warm air is leaving and air is leaking into your home. This can reduce the efficiency of your energy consumption. This issue can be addressed, so it is worth fixing as soon as you can.

Every double-glazed window has an elastomer that holds the two panes together. The seal prevents the leaking of moisture between the windows. However should it become damaged or worn, it could cause fogging. This can happen due to inadequate installation drainage issues, poor installation, or even faulty seals from the manufacturer.

This is a problem that is common to double-glazed windows. It happens when the temperature in your home drops drastically in the evening, causing condensation to form on the cold side of the window. The good news is that it is a natural phenomenon and can be easily eliminated by using a condensation removal kit.

Double-glazed windows that are misted are not only unsightly to behold, but they also compromise the soundproofing and thermal insulation of your home. When you first detect this issue, contact a double-glazed windows repair specialist.

The first step to fix a window that has become misty is to take the affected unit from its frame. After the window has been disassembled it is possible to remove the glass panes individually. Then you can clean and dry each window pane before reassembling it.

In most cases, replacing or fixing a misted glass is the best choice. Filling the sealant in double-glazed windows is not a solution that lasts forever, and it can cause further damage. It is more efficient and cost-effective to replace the window unit.

A professional installation of a double-glazed window will avoid future problems. It's important to choose a professional who will install your windows in a proper manner and will perform regular maintenance. You should also select A-rated windows for maximum energy efficiency.

Foggy

Foggy windows are not only unsightly, but they can also indicate a bigger issue with the seal. Double-paned windows feature an airtight sealing between two panes to keep the temperature stable and provide good insulation. Over time, this seal could fail or break opening up condensation and water into the window. This can result in a sticky buildup, or worse, moisture may seep between the glasses and cause damage to the.

One common solution to this issue is to put a dehumidifier near the window, which can help remove some of the moisture. This won't solve the issue at its source that is an inadequate airtight seal.

Another solution is to use a drain snake or hanger wrapped with pantyhose and drill an opening small in the window. However, this won't prevent the moisture from re-forming in the future and it could be a challenge to wipe off the glass due to the gaps between the panes.

Alternately, you could try to improve air circulation in the space in which the window is situated, which may help reduce the humidity levels. You can also use the extractor fan when you are cooking or showering, and open windows to dry your clothes.

Contacting a professional double-glazing business to repair or replace the glass is the best way to handle fogging. This involves taking the window off to repair the seal between two panes. The process can take a long time and can cost a significant amount of money.

In the past, the only other solutions to fogging in insulated glass windows were to live with it or replace the whole window unit. However, some companies are now offering an option to restore and even repair a foggy double-glazed window. This is much less expensive than full-window replacement.
